This patch is to replace all the instances of winehq.com by winehq.org
in the various files of the Wine distribution: documentation, comments,
etc.
There's also one pointer to appdb.codeweavers.com changed to
appdb.winehq.org.
I didn't touch at the ChangeLog and ChangeLog.Old files, and to an old
email from Alexandre in documentation/HOWTO-Winelib, as I don't think
it's a good idea to change such things.
A similar patch has also been sent to web-admin at winehq.org, to change
the files on the website. After the application of both, the only
remaining thing would be the name of the CVS module (Winehq_com).
Please comment.
